Struct direct2d::stroke_style::StrokeStyle
[−]
[src]
pub struct StrokeStyle { /* fields omitted */ }
Methods
impl StrokeStyle
[src]
pub unsafe fn get_ptr(&self) -> *mut ID2D1StrokeStyle1
[src]
pub fn get_start_cap(&self) -> Result<CapStyle, D2D1Error>
[src]
pub fn get_end_cap(&self) -> Result<CapStyle, D2D1Error>
[src]
pub fn get_dash_cap(&self) -> Result<CapStyle, D2D1Error>
[src]
pub fn get_miter_limit(&self) -> f32
[src]
pub fn get_line_join(&self) -> Result<LineJoin, D2D1Error>
[src]
pub fn get_dash_offset(&self) -> f32
[src]
pub fn get_dash_style(&self) -> Result<DashStyle, D2D1Error>
[src]
pub fn get_dashes_count(&self) -> u32
[src]
pub fn get_dashes(&self) -> Vec<f32>
[src]
Trait Implementations
impl Clone for StrokeStyle
[src]
fn clone(&self) -> StrokeStyle
[src]
Returns a copy of the value. Read more
fn clone_from(&mut self, source: &Self)
1.0.0[src]
Performs copy-assignment from source
. Read more